Output 269051e89483091e20d4d3e0428c50073a80fec30b8df7a485b7c18af3ae2f5a:0

value
15019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1168ce8eb28ed40d9372c559537a4433fd04e13c OP_EQUAL
address
33H4xuwHw7uvimiMDNf8bxh5c9VM1HiJL4
transaction
269051e89483091e20d4d3e0428c50073a80fec30b8df7a485b7c18af3ae2f5a
spent
true